v0.59.1

This patch release backports quic-go/quic-go#5642, which adds validation for HTTP/3 trailers.

v0.59.0

This release adds a couple of new features:

  • Adds an API to peek stream data on ReceiveStream and Stream: #5501
  • Adds an API to peek the next varint on a stream: #5502
  • Reworks the API exposed by the HTTP/3 package for WebTransport: #5509, #5512. Regular HTTP/3 use cases should not be affected by these changes.
  • Adds support for HTTP request trailers (trailers sent by the client): #5507

Breaking Changes

  • Removes the deprecated ClientHelloInfo: #5497
  • Removes the deprecated ConnectionTracingID and ConnectionTracingKey: #5521
  • http3: the qlogger is now closed after all streams have been handled: #5524
  • The ConnectionState now reports both the local and the remote status of the QUIC Datagram and Reliable Stream Reset extensions: #5533

Other Notable Fixes

  • Fixes an infinite loop of PING-only packets caused by a bug in the PTO queueing logic: #5538 and #5539
  • http3: Fixes a race condition between new request streams and GOAWAY: #5522
  • qlog: Fixes a race condition between RecordEvent and Close: #5523

Release 1.79.3

Security

  • server: fix an authorization bypass where malformed :path headers (missing the leading slash) could bypass path-based restricted "deny" rules in interceptors like grpc/authz. Any request with a non-canonical path is now immediately rejected with an Unimplemented error. (#8981)

Release 1.79.2

Bug Fixes

  • stats: Prevent redundant error logging in health/ORCA producers by skipping stats/tracing processing when no stats handler is configured. (grpc/grpc-go#8874)

Release 1.79.1

Bug Fixes

Release 1.79.0

API Changes

  • mem: Add experimental API SetDefaultBufferPool to change the default buffer pool. (#8806)
  • experimental/stats: Update MetricsRecorder to require embedding the new UnimplementedMetricsRecorder (a no-op struct) in all implementations for forward compatibility. (#8780)

Behavior Changes

  • balancer/weightedtarget: Remove handling of Addresses and only handle Endpoints in resolver updates. (#8841)

New Features

  • experimental/stats: Add support for asynchronous gauge metrics through the new AsyncMetricReporter and RegisterAsyncReporter APIs. (#8780)
  • pickfirst: Add support for weighted random shuffling of endpoints, as described in gRFC A113.
    • This is enabled by default, and can be turned off using the environment variable GRPC_EXPERIMENTAL_PF_WEIGHTED_SHUFFLING. (#8864)
  • xds: Implement :authority rewriting, as specified in gRFC A81. (#8779)
  • balancer/randomsubsetting: Implement the random_subsetting LB policy, as specified in gRFC A68. (#8650)

Bug Fixes

  • credentials/tls: Fix a bug where the port was not stripped from the authority override before validation. (#8726)
  • xds/priority: Fix a bug causing delayed failover to lower-priority clusters when a higher-priority cluster is stuck in CONNECTING state. (#8813)
  • health: Fix a bug where health checks failed for clients using legacy compression options (WithDecompressor or RPCDecompressor). (#8765)
  • transport: Fix an issue where the HTTP/2 server could skip header size checks when terminating a stream early. (#8769)
  • server: Propagate status detail headers, if available, when terminating a stream during request header processing. (#8754)

Performance Improvements

  • credentials/alts: Optimize read buffer alignment to reduce copies. (#8791)
  • mem: Optimize pooling and creation of buffer objects. (#8784)
  • transport: Reduce slice re-allocations by reserving slice capacity. (#8797)

[1.43.0/0.65.0/0.19.0] 2026-04-02

Added

  • Add IsRandom and WithRandom on TraceFlags, and IsRandom on SpanContext in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/trace for W3C Trace Context Level 2 Random Trace ID Flag support. (#8012)
  • Add service detection with WithService in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/sdk/resource. (#7642)
  • Add DefaultWithContext and EnvironmentWithContext in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/sdk/resource to support plumbing context.Context through default and environment detectors. (#8051)
  • Support attributes with empty value (attribute.EMPTY) in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/exporters/otlp/otlptrace/otlptracegrpc. (#8038)
  • Support attributes with empty value (attribute.EMPTY) in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/exporters/otlp/otlpmetric/otlpmetricgrpc. (#8038)
  • Support attributes with empty value (attribute.EMPTY) in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/exporters/otlp/otlplog/otlploggrpc. (#8038)
  • Support attributes with empty value (attribute.EMPTY) in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/exporters/otlp/otlptrace/otlptracehttp. (#8038)
  • Support attributes with empty value (attribute.EMPTY) in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/exporters/otlp/otlpmetric/otlpmetrichttp. (#8038)
  • Support attributes with empty value (attribute.EMPTY) in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/exporters/otlp/otlplog/otlploghttp. (#8038)
  • Support attributes with empty value (attribute.EMPTY) in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/sdk/metric/metricdata/metricdatatest. (#8038)
  • Add support for per-series start time tracking for cumulative metrics in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/sdk/metric. Set OTEL_GO_X_PER_SERIES_START_TIMESTAMPS=true to enable. (#8060)
  • Add WithCardinalityLimitSelector for metric reader for configuring cardinality limits specific to the instrument kind. (#7855)

Changed

  • Introduce the EMPTY Type in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/attribute to reflect that an empty value is now a valid value, with INVALID remaining as a deprecated alias of EMPTY. (#8038)
  • Improve slice handling in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/attribute to optimize short slice values with fixed-size fast paths. (#8039)
  • Improve performance of span metric recording in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/sdk/trace by returning early if self-observability is not enabled. (#8067)
  • Improve formatting of metric data diffs in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/sdk/metric/metricdata/metricdatatest. (#8073)

Deprecated

  • Deprecate INVALID in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/attribute. Use EMPTY instead. (#8038)

Fixed

  • Return spec-compliant TraceIdRatioBased description. This is a breaking behavioral change, but it is necessary to make the implementation spec-compliant. (#8027)
  • Fix a race condition in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/sdk/metric where the lastvalue aggregation could collect the value 0 even when no zero-value measurements were recorded. (#8056)
  • Limit HTTP response body to 4 MiB in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/exporters/otlp/otlptrace/otlptracehttp to mitigate excessive memory usage caused by a misconfigured or malicious server. Responses exceeding the limit are treated as non-retryable errors. (#8108)
  • Limit HTTP response body to 4 MiB in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/exporters/otlp/otlpmetric/otlpmetrichttp to mitigate excessive memory usage caused by a misconfigured or malicious server. Responses exceeding the limit are treated as non-retryable errors. (#8108)
  • Limit HTTP response body to 4 MiB in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/exporters/otlp/otlplog/otlploghttp to mitigate excessive memory usage caused by a misconfigured or malicious server. Responses exceeding the limit are treated as non-retryable errors. (#8108)
  • WithHostID detector in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/sdk/resource to use full path for kenv command on BSD. (#8113)
  • Fix missing request.GetBody in go.opentelemetry.io/otel/exporters/otlp/otlplog/otlploghttp to correctly handle HTTP2 GOAWAY frame. (#8096)
